1. Darjeeling (West Bengal) – Tea Gardens & Himalayan Views

  • Keywords: Darjeeling Himalayan Railway, Tiger Hill sunrise, zoos

  • Why there: Ride the historic toy train, visit tea estates, enjoy a view of Kanchenjunga at sunrise, and visit Padmaja Naidu Zoo

  • Estimated cost for 2 people: ₹15,000–₹25,000 for a 4–5 day trip

  • Best time: April to June.

2. Jaipur (Rajasthan) – Royal Heritage & Cultural Richness

  • Why families love it: Explore Amer Fort, City Palace, Hawa Mahal, enjoy traditional puppet shows, elephant rides, and local Rajasthani cuisine

  • Cost: Mid‑range heritage hotels plus guided tours make it ₹5,000–₹7,000/day for a family.

  • Best time: October to March.

3. Jim Corbett National Park (Uttarakhand) – Wildlife Safari Adventure

  • Why go: Kids and adults enjoy safaris spotting tigers, elephants, and birds; educational and exciting

  • Cost: Approx ₹6,000–₹12,000 per person for 2–3 days including safari and stay

  • Best time: November to February.

4. Andaman & Nicobar Islands – Tropical Beach Paradise

  • Why it’s special: Families dive, snorkel, take glass‑bottom boat rides, and explore both natural beauty and historical sites like the Cellular Jail

  • Cost: Island vacation costlier—approx ₹30,000–₹50,000 for a few days (travel, stay, activities).

  • Best time: November to April.

5. Gangtok (Sikkim) – Peaceful Mountains & Spiritual Touch

  • monasteries, scenic lakes, cultural peace

  • Why families enjoy it: Quiet, spiritual yet scenic—visit Rumtek Monastery, Tsomgo Lake, vibrant markets

  • Cost: Mid‑range—₹5,000–₹7,000/day including stays and local transport.

  • Best time: March to June and September to December.

6. Nainital (Uttarakhand) – Lakeside Tranquility

  • Naini Lake, cable car, mountain hikes

  • Why visit: Boating, ropeway to scenic viewpoints, exploring caves and nature—great for children and elders

  • Cost: Moderate—₹3,000–₹5,000/day for a family.

  • Best time: March to June and September to November.

7. Hampi (Karnataka) – Ancient Ruins and Rustic Charm

  • Why families love it: Explore ancient temples, climb boulders, learn history in an engaging way

  • Cost: Budget-friendly—₹2,500–₹4,000/day for a family, including guides.

  • Best time: October to March.

9. Varanasi (Uttar Pradesh)

  • Ganga Aarti, ancient ghats, spiritual heritage

  • Why visit: Family boat rides, temple visits, rich spiritual and cultural experience

  • Best time: November to February.

  • Cost: ₹3,000–₹5,000/day for basic comfort and sightseeing.

10.Kanyakumari (Tamil Nadu)

  • sunrise & sunset views, statues & memorials, serene beaches, cultural heritage, family-friendly sightseeing

  • Why visit: Families can explore the Vivekananda Rock Memorial, Thiruvalluvar Statue, and serene beaches. It’s rich in culture, spirituality, and natural beauty.

  • Best time: The ideal time to visit is October to March. Budget-friendly.

  • Cost: ₹3,000–₹5,000/day for basic comfort and sightseeing.
